It is called Hippocampus. The hippocampus is a little organ situated inside the cerebrum's average fleeting flap and structures a vital piece of the limbic framework, the area that directs feelings. The hippocampus is related principally with memory, specifically, long haul memory. The organ additionally assumes a critical part in spatial route.

Reinforcement refers to do something that will make the behavior to take place <u>more frequently</u>. It can be positive or negative:
- Positive reinforcement: consists in GIVING something we like that will reinforce the conduct
- Negative reinforcement: consists in TAKING away something we don't like so that the conduct will be reinforced.
On the other way, punishments refers to do something that will make the behavior occur <u>less frequently</u>. I can also be positive or negative:
- Negative punishment: consists in TAKING AWAY something we like, so the conduct is punished.
- Positive punishment: consists in GIVING something we don't like, so the conduct is punished.
